Defining "Refurbished": Beyond a Simple Clean-Up

The term "refurbished" is often used loosely. A true, quality-assured refurbishment is a systematic process. It's far more than a cosmetic detail or a simple battery charge. Understanding this hierarchy is your first defense against poor quality.

"Used" or "second-hand" typically means sold as-is, with no guarantee of function or safety. "Reconditioned" might imply some basic checks, but the scope is undefined. "Certified Refurbished" should indicate a documented process performed to a specific standard, often by the original manufacturer or an authorized partner. This process includes diagnostics, part replacement, testing, and certification.

The lack of a universal legal definition for "refurbished" places the burden of verification on you, the buyer. The presence of a detailed standard is what transforms a used product into a reliable one. The Battery: The Heart of the E-Bike (and Your Safety)

The battery pack is the most critical—and potentially hazardous—component in an e-bike. A proper refurbishment standard must address it with utmost rigor. A simple voltage check is utterly insufficient.

The gold standard involves a full diagnostic cycle to measure remaining capacity against the original specification. More importantly, safety certification is paramount. The battery should either be a brand-new replacement or the existing pack should be recertified to meet UL 2271 (standard for lithium-ion battery systems) or be part of a system meeting UL 2849 (the electrical system standard for e-bikes).

These UL standards test for electrical, mechanical, and environmental safety, including overcharge, short circuit, and crush tests. Mechanical and Electrical Systems Inspection

A comprehensive, checklist-driven inspection of all mechanical and electrical components is non-negotiable. This process should be documented and should follow a published standard or a detailed internal protocol.

The inspection must cover frame integrity, checking for cracks, bends, or damage at weld points and alignment. The brake system requires examination of pad thickness, rotor condition, and hydraulic line integrity (if applicable), with worn parts replaced. The drivetrain—chain, cassette, and derailleur—must be assessed for wear and adjusted or replaced.

Electrically, every connection from the motor to the controller, display, and sensors must be checked for corrosion, secure seating, and proper insulation. The motor itself should be tested for smooth engagement and lack of unusual noise. This holistic approach ensures the bike functions as a cohesive, reliable system.

Water Resistance and Durability Certification

An e-bike's ability to withstand the elements is defined by its Ingress Protection (IP) rating. A proper refurbishment must re-establish this rating, which can degrade over time through seal wear or casing damage.

The process involves inspecting and replacing critical seals and gaskets on the motor, battery casing, display, and controller. The goal is to restore the bike to its original IP rating, such as IPX5 (protected against water jets from any direction), a common standard for commuter models. This is not just about puddles; it's about protecting sensitive electronics from moisture-induced failure.

The Buyer's Checklist: How to Verify Quality Before You Purchase

Armed with knowledge of the standards, you must now apply it. This checklist translates theory into actionable verification steps, whether you're buying online or in person.

Questions to Ask the Seller or Refurbisher

Always demand clear answers. Ask: "What is the tested remaining capacity of the battery, and what diagnostic equipment was used?" Follow up with, "Can you provide the UL certification details (UL 2271 or 2849) for the battery or electrical system?" These questions target the heart of safety.

Then, inquire about the process: "Can you share your detailed refurbishment checklist or the standard you follow (e.g., a specific ISO standard or internal protocol)?" Finally, nail down the coverage: "What are the exact terms, duration, and components covered under the warranty? Is it a parts-and-labor warranty?" Vague answers are a major red flag.

Physical and Documentation Inspection Points

If inspecting physically, look beyond shine. Check the frame for any hairline cracks or repair signs, especially near stress points. Examine brake rotors for deep scoring and pads for adequate material. Inspect the battery casing for swelling, cracks, or damaged connectors.

Most importantly, request documentation. A reputable refurbisher should provide an itemized service report listing replaced parts (e.g., "new brake pads, model XYZ"), tested parameters ("battery capacity: 90% of original"), and verification of passed tests ("IPX5 spray test passed"). The absence of such documentation suggests an undocumented, and therefore unverifiable, process.

Understanding Different Refurbishment Tiers

Not all refurbished e-bikes are created equal. The market often segments them into tiers based on the depth of the refurbishment process and the resulting condition. Recognizing these tiers helps set realistic expectations.

Tier Common Label Typical Process Battery Handling Warranty
Premium Certified Refurbished (Manufacturer) Full OEM-spec process, meets original factory standards. New or recertified to original spec with full diagnostics. Comprehensive, often 1 year (parts & labor).
Standard Professionally Refurbished Thorough third-party process, replaces worn consumables. Tested for capacity & safety, may not have full UL re-cert. Limited, often 90-180 days on key components.
Basic Reconditioned / Serviced Cosmetic cleaning, basic safety check (brakes, lights). Charged and "tested to work." No capacity guarantee. Very short or none ("as-is").

As the table shows, the tier directly correlates with the standards applied. Common Pitfalls and Red Flags to Avoid

Being aware of common warning signs can prevent a costly mistake. Avoid any seller who is evasive about the bike's history or the refurbishment details. If they cannot or will not provide specific answers to the checklist questions, walk away.

Be highly skeptical of listings with only stock photos and no detailed, high-resolution images of the actual bike, especially the battery, drivetrain, and any potential scratch/dent areas. A price that seems too good to be true almost always is, usually indicating skipped safety checks or the use of non-certified battery replacements.

Finally, beware of vague or non-existent warranty terms. Phrases like "sold as-seen" or "final sale" are clear indicators that the seller assumes no responsibility for the product's function or safety after payment. These are hallmarks of the lowest tier of refurbishment, where the standards we've discussed are entirely absent.

Can a refurbished e-bike battery be as good as new?

A professionally tested and certified refurbished battery can perform reliably and safely, meeting its original capacity specification. However, all lithium-ion batteries degrade with time and cycles. A refurbished battery may have a slightly reduced total lifespan compared to a brand-new one. The "gold standard" is a brand-new, certified replacement battery installed during refurbishment.

Are all parts replaced during refurbishment?

No. A quality refurbishment follows a "replace as needed" protocol based on wear inspection. Consumable parts like brake pads, tires, and grips are commonly replaced. Critical safety or performance parts (like a degraded battery) are replaced. The drivetrain may be serviced or replaced depending on wear. The key is that the process is documented.
